    Abstract: A transmission device includes: a storage unit that holds test data used for checking occurrence/nonoccurrence of a communication abnormality; a serial conversion unit that converts image data to be transmitted and the test data stored in the storage unit into serial data; a transmission unit that transmits the serial data converted by the serial conversion unit to a reception device; and an initialization unit that, when an instruction of particular initialization is inputted, performs initialization on other circuits than the storage unit without performing initialization on the storage unit.

    Abstract: A multiple control station (201) transmits a first broadcast frame including a first identifier for identifying a first host (202) and a second broadcast frame including a second identifier for identifying a second host (203) to a terminal station (52) over a wireless channel using time division. The multiple control station then receives a connection request frame that requests connection with the first host (202) or the second host (203) from the terminal station (52). Arbitration is then performed so that the terminal station is connected to the first host or the second host in accordance with the first identifier or the second identifier included in the received connection request frame.

    Abstract: A relaying apparatus of the present invention is interposed between a device and a printer and controls the operation of the device by checking the status of the printer. The relaying apparatus has a microcomputer that causes an IrDA unit to negotiate with a printer. The printer has a microcomputer that associates a setting state of a print data correction switch with an equipment name and gives the equipment name to the relaying apparatus when a negotiation begins. The microcomputer of the relaying apparatus performs image processing based on the equipment name obtained from the printer and does not request the device to send new image data while the printer is operating according to the setting state of the print data correction switch.

    Abstract: An interface for facilitating facsimile transmission via a wireless communications device operatively connected to a wireless communications network, including: a modem suitable for being communicatively coupled to a facsimile machine; a controller coupled to the modem; and, a memory operatively coupled to the controller. The interface includes code to cause the modem to transmit a retrain request to the facsimile machine upon expiration of a given temporal period. The interface includes a circuit for selectively generating a ring signal corresponding to a plain old telephone service ring signal. The interface includes a circuit for selectively generating a hold signal corresponding to a plain old telephone service hold signal. And, the circuit includes code to cause the modem to transmit data indicative of white lines to the facsimile machine upon expiration of a given temporal period.

    Abstract: The subject of the invention is a method for downloading data from multiple cameras for omnidirectional image recording, and a device for downloading data from multiple cameras for omnidirectional image recording, used to download the data from data from multiple cameras at once. It is characterised by the cameras being connected to USB ports of the integrator (1), whereas the charging current of each of the cameras (2) connected to the integrator is limited, then a connection being opened to each of the cameras (2) connected to the integrator and the memories made available by individual cameras (2) being mounted as sub-folders of a dedicated folder, after which the dedicated folder is made available and the integrator (1) is connected by an USB cable (3) to a computer's USB port and a connection is started with the integrator (1), where N threads are started and data are downloaded from the folders made available by the cameras (2) and mapped by the integrator (1) in N threads. The device is characterised by a set of cameras (2) being connected directly through USB ports (3) to an integrator (1), which opens a connection with each of the cameras (2) and mounts the memory resource which is made available by the camera (2) as a sub-folder of the main folder, after which the main folder with mapped sub-folders is made available to the user's computer through an USB port.

    Abstract: Disclosed is a multimedia system using a mobile communication terminal and an external connection device for the same. The multimedia system uses a video/audio output device, a peripheral device, and an external connection device. The multimedia system includes a mobile communication terminal having a video/audio output function and a peripheral device control function so that the mobile communication terminal outputs images and sounds by using the video/audio output device and controls the peripheral device; and an external connection device for connecting the mobile communication terminal to the video/audio output device and the peripheral device, relaying the images and sounds from the mobile communication terminal to the video/audio output device, and relaying data transmitted/received between the mobile communication terminal and the peripheral device. When multimedia data is reproduced by using a mobile communication terminal, it is easily connected to an external video/audio output device (e.g. a TV) or a peripheral device (e.g. a computer, a mouse, a joystick) to construct a multimedia system.
